Transaction 504ca4fc714202ba9763140063770263bb25d202f87236fbf6039dbfa91e800a
1 Input
1 Output
-
504ca4fc714202ba9763140063770263bb25d202f87236fbf6039dbfa91e800a:0
- value
- 993872
- script pubkey
- OP_0 OP_PUSHBYTES_20 c160dc38d9a1bcff2bfef9a4b12481936ea0f65c
- address
- bc1qc9sdcwxe5x7072l7lxjtzfypjdh2pajufaxpap